AI FIRST DEVELOPMENT APPROACH

Campspot is building a new AI-native platform that is purpose-built to bring intelligent automation, dynamic tooling, and agentic workflows to our product ecosystem. It is an actively evolving codebase where every feature shipped matters and where AI-assisted development is not a convenience but a core part of how we build.


THE ROLE

We are looking for a skilled software developer to accelerate feature development on the AI platform using Claude Code as their primary AI coding assistant. You will work alongside our core team to scope, build, and ship new capabilities using Claude Code to drive velocity while maintaining code quality, architectural integrity, and security best practices.


Responsibilities:

  • Use Claude Code to implement new features and functions within the platform
  • Translate product requirements and design specs into clean, production-ready code
  • Review and refine AI-generated code to ensure correctness, performance, and maintainability
  • Leverage AI to write and update automated tests for all new functionality
  • Participate in async code reviews and provide constructive feedback
  • Ensure new features, APIs, and architectural decisions are documented as they are built
  • Proactively identify technical debt or gaps and surface them to the team


Requirements:

  • 5+ years of professional software development experience
  • Experience shipping features on fast-moving platforms
  • Demonstrated experience working with Claude Code
  • Understanding of prompt engineering and context window management
  • Prior experience building on top of the Anthropic API or integrating LLMs into production applications
  • Familiarity with agentic workflow patterns and tool-use APIs
  • Strong proficiency in TypeScript and React
  • Solid understanding of REST APIs, async patterns, and modern web architecture
  • Ability to work independently, manage your own time, and hit milestones
  • Able to communicate complex technical concepts, lead discussions, and collaborate effectively with stakeholders across all levels.

Campspot is a motivated team of outdoor enthusiasts and software professionals with decades of experience in the campground and outdoor industry. We’re looking to grow with people who embody our culture of learning, collaboration, and innovation. Today our portfolio includes two distinct but synergistic products: 

1. Campspot Management Software (https://software.campspot.com/) is the leading provider of reservation management software and tools for campgrounds and RV parks. It revolutionized the industry through its proprietary technology, allowing park owners to increase revenue through its inventory optimization tool and site-lock capabilities. 

2. The Campspot Marketplace (campspot.com and Campspot mobile app) is an online marketplace where travelers can find accommodations for their camping trips. Campspot’s inventory is 100% bookable and includes robust filters to help travelers customize their travel experience.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
